The roots of yoga dates back to approximately 5000 years. Sage Patanjali, Lord Buddha, Swami Atmarama, Maha Avatar Babaji are all pioneer of the most orthodox science of India. Through them started the Guru- Disciple lineage of Yoga and thus are the various forms.
Hatha Yoga, Kriya Yoga, Bhakti yoga, Raja Yoga,
Ashtang Yoga are a few of them. Although all of them are the branches of the same tree which yields the fruit of Self- Realization and merging back to the origin, yet they are named differently to suit different cultures and varied genders across the geography.
THE AUSPICIOUS DAY
The foundation stone of Yogsadhna was laid on May 6
th 2001 by Dr. Indu Arora with the blessings of
Guru Mrs. Shashi Khosla, parents and well wishers in the hometown Ghaziabad, Uttar Pradesh, India. The day was chosen as a tribute to the anniversary of her teacher.
THE SPREAD IN THE CITY
Dr. Indu started the yoga class without any advertisement or media support, with the mission to educate and help mankind through the yogic
Kriyas. She got her first student on the first day and then there was no looking back. The goodwill spread in no time as a word of mouth. She had many batches running throughout the day spread over the weekdays. She started taking workshops on Yoga as a Therapy in various clubs like The Rotary, Lion Club, Women's Club and many public and private gatherings. Her motive was crystal clear "To help people" the best she could with the knowledge she gained with the study of Yoga in Pune, also utilizing her Diploma in Naturopath and Doctorate in Alternative Medicine. People from all professions, ages, cultures, economic status, suffering from simple to complex ailments were soon become a part of Yogsadhna. Yogsadhna was now a name in the field of Yoga in Ghaziabad.
